Bea M. Bond, 75, of Poplarville, Misissippi passed away Wednesday, April 10, 2013 in the care of her family.
Anative of Maryland, Ms. Bond was a devoted Mother, Grandmother, and Friend. She was a member of Juniper Grove Baptist Church; served as cook for the Pearl River Baptist Association during many mission trips stateside and abroad; and was an Election Commissioner with Pearl River County from November 1998 until December 2008.
She is preceded in death by her parents, Schuyler and Lilly Helferstay Marks.
Survivors include three sons, Brian (Andrea) Bond of Poplarville, MS, Kirk Bond of Biloxi, MS, and Lance Bond of Poplarville, MS; one daughter, Donna (Eddie) Chester of Lumberton, MS; one brother, Armond (Sue) Marks of Dacula, GA ; five grandchildren, Chris Bond, Rachel Bond, Jason Bond, Hollie Chester, and Nicholas Chester; and one niece, Linda (Jerry) Robbins.
Funeral services will be 3:00 pm, Friday, April 12, 2013 at Juniper Grove Baptist Church with interment in the church cemetery. Visitation will be two hours prior to the service, Friday at the church.
Pallbearers will be Deacons of Juniper Grove Baptist Church.
In lieu of flowers, memorials may be directed to the Pearl River Baptist Association Honduras Mission Ministry, PO Box 489, McNeill, MS 39457.
